Transaction c29750baa282b6cd76bf237cddeef882edf69a3dfe232e2cbbe386ca664fb1aa

45 Input
2 Outputs
  • c29750baa282b6cd76bf237cddeef882edf69a3dfe232e2cbbe386ca664fb1aa:0
  • value  255450
    address  13MQwhNPcXdHGGM8UQQouFUNSHdkdL4b1x
  • c29750baa282b6cd76bf237cddeef882edf69a3dfe232e2cbbe386ca664fb1aa:1
  • value  39217000
    address  3CuBGtHU67iPHt95nyCzwFZcNzdmBxgFXN